The Receptionist / Office Assistant position is a highly visible and essential position.
This role is a support to our current receptionist for the overflow work.
The general duties of this role include answering incoming calls, scheduling, clerical, and project-based work, in addition to direct client contact and service.
Position Responsibilities :
Answer inbound phone and email inquiries and route to appropriate staff and team members.
Directly greet and service clients for scheduled appointments as well as impromptu visits.
Hospitality : Coffee and Cookies for clients and staff.
Create and modify documents utilizing Microsoft Office including Word documents and Excel spreadsheets.
Manage, organize and update relevant data using database applications.
Perform general clerical duties including but not limited to photocopying, faxing, mailing and shipping.
Maintains safe and clean reception area.
Assume other duties as required and assigned.
